Meaning of no free fluid in the cul de sac?

No free fluid in the cul de sac is a medical term. It means that there was no indication of a ruptured cyst or ectopic pregnancy found on a pelvic ultrasound.


What does it mean by no fluid is seen in cul de sac?

When no fluid is seen in the cul de sac, it typically means there is no abnormal accumulation of fluid in the space between the uterus and rectum. This finding is common during imaging studies such as ultrasounds and is generally considered normal.

Where does the fluid go when a ovarian cyst ruptures?

When an ovarian cyst ruptures, the fluid ends up in the cul-de-sac due to gravity.

What will happen to a person if there's no free fluid in the cul de sac?

That's a good finding. What will happen to the person next depends on the symptoms she's having and the results of the history, exam, and other testing.
